Project Objective • Achieving improved health status among socially excluded

communities through provisioning of improved WASH services.• Empowering marginalized communities and local institutions to

develop their leadership and decision making to secure their WASH rights.

• Promoting an effective, equitable and inclusive WASH service delivery mechanism by sensitizing and enhancing accountability of service provider.

Efforts Taken to influence Govt.• The organisation organised 4-5 networking meeting for scaling up the

sanitation and hygiene program at the block.

• Education department block office passed an order to all the schools at pahadgarh block to cooperate and promote the hygiene activity in their schools.

• Dharti Started an awareness program on rural water supply scheme at pahadgarh, kailaras, jaura and sabalgarh block with the combined effort of MP Janabhiyaan Parishad.

• We had prepared a plan to construct combined sanitation facilities at one place for all communities at all the hilly areas and sharing with TSC coordinator and panchayat department. Both are agreed working on the plan during 2012-13 .

• Continues deferent Media person visit in project area.

Challenges:

• About 50% of the project area is water scarce.• 11-Village of the project area are on stony soil so

digging for leach pit is a challenge to us.• The reach of resources at project area is also a

challenge.• Very few transportation facilities are available at

the project area and charges are also very high.• Intersectoral Convergence.• Low capacity of Panchayat.

Learning's:• Community monitoring system with the support of NGO to

stop corruption:At Jaderu Panchayat 3 new school toilet were

sanctioned but the sarpanch renovate the old building and showed as new construction. VWSC raised its voice against the issue with our support. After a long debate and verification Janpad panchayat ordered recovery of the funds.

• Public hearing can proved to be a very good tool to address the problems and solving at local level

• Systematic efforts would be made to take up non functional existing water sources.

• With the help of community good models would be created on Water, sanitation and Hygiene program.
